Mrs. Kane Wins a War

The Hill Gang and the River Gang are rivals. These young hoodlums like battling one another on the back of Mrs. Kane’s property just outside of Knotty Pine. She called the police on their latest fight. The gangs plan to resume their interrupted fight the very next night. Then they intend to get revenge on Mrs. Kane herself!

Set the Record Straight.

Two misbehaving boys, Justin and Peter, must stay after school as punishment for working on sports plays instead of paying attention in class. The boys tell their parents that their teacher Miss Anderson is prejudiced against sports because she is crippled. Both of the boys’ fathers want Miss Anderson punished or worse.

RB037 The Shortage

The ShortageJohn Patterson is the Forest Service accountant for the Northwest District and one of Bill’s rangers. John is a fine Christian and works hard to do a good job. But recently John has been worrying himself sick over an accounting error of thousands of dollars that he can’t find to correct. He won’t tell anyone or ask for help and a federal audit is only days away.

RB036 Sleeping Death

RB034 – Sleeping Death – Sleeping Sickness infects the Central City area. Local manpower and equipment are not enough to control the mosquito population. The rangers are called in to help spray for mosquitoes, but one large land owner won’t allow the spraying on his land leaving many in danger of infection.

RB034 Piggyback

RB034 – Piggyback – Dangerous winter weather and complex delivery problems threaten the survival of both Canyon City Truck Lines and the railroad. Len Grant, owner of CCTL, and Spence Neihoff, superintendent of the Knotty Pine railroad district, do not get along and refuse to work with one another. Bill must teach these men how to work together instead of against each other.
